Side-by-Side Nutrition Facts

Nutrient Coleslaw Eggplant Better
Calories 99kcal 25kcal Eggplant
Protein 0.8g 1g Eggplant
Total Fat 6.7g 0.2g Eggplant
Carbohydrates 9.5g 5.9g Coleslaw
Fiber 1.3g 3g Eggplant
Sugar 7g 3.5g Eggplant
Vitamin C 18mg 2.2mg Coleslaw
Calcium 34mg 9mg Coleslaw
Iron 0.4mg 0.2mg Coleslaw
Potassium 125mg 229mg Eggplant

Coleslaw vs Eggplant — Key Takeaway

Eggplant has 74 fewer calories per 100g than Coleslaw, making it the lighter option. Coleslaw provides 18mg of vitamin C.
